Poor prep work causing MULTIPLE issues. I had a scheduled surgery for December 4th. I tried to get an estimate. They didn't know the anesthesiologist costs, but gave me a number to call to find out. That number was a direct personal cell phone to an IT guy at the company in Texas, he didn't know how to help. On December 3rd, the day before surgery, this surgical center called me saying they don't accept my insurance. They didn't check on this ahead of time. I asked if I can just pay the same contracted rates and do it all out of pocket, because I'm on an HSA and it would all be out of pocket either way for me. They said it would be roughly $3500 more. So I cancelled. I now have to change all my month's plans, reschedule for summer, and change my family planned summer vacations then. I'm also out a $250 doctor consultation because they're required within 30 days of surgery. This place just doesn't double check anything properly and it cost me time and money.
